The Lahore High Court here Tuesday issued notices to federal government and Wapda chairman in a petition seeking directions for federal government to disclose all under construction projects aimed at ending power crisis. A bar member Rana Ilamudin Ghazi filed the petition questioning the failure of government functionaries to overcome power crisis.
Petitioner prayed to the court direct the government to submit the details of all international agreements on power production before the court, especially the agreements with China. He has claimed that China had offered Pakistan to supply domestic and commercial electricity connection on Rs 500 and Rs 3000 per month respectively.
